官网:https://chat.openai.com/chat 2、登录到你的 OpenAI 账号 在主页上找到“API Keys”部分,并点击“Create API Key”按钮。 在弹出的对话框中输入 API 密钥的描述(例如“My API Key”),然后点击“Create”按钮。 你的 API 密钥会出现在“API Keys”部分,你可以复制它并将它保存到你的代码中。 二、PH...
在PHP 语言中,我们可以借助 GuzzleHttp Library 以及 ReactPHP Library 等工具库,通过 SSE 技术来实现 OpenAI 的 API 接口的调用和流式输出。以下是具体的代码 代码语言:javascript 代码运行次数:0 use GuzzleHttp\Client;use GuzzleHttp\Event\CompleteEvent;use GuzzleHttp\Event\MessageCompleteEvent;use GuzzleHttp\...
Add a description, image, and links to the openai-php-sdk topic page so that developers can more easily learn about it. Curate this topic Add this topic to your repo To associate your repository with the openai-php-sdk topic, visit your repo's landing page and select "manage topics...
要使用PHP对接OpenAI API,可以按照以下步骤进行操作:创建OpenAI账户并获取API密钥。安装PHP的curl扩展以便向OpenAI API发送HTTP请求。创建一个PHP文件,命名为openai.php,用于与OpenAI API进行通信。在openai.php中设置HTTP头部,包括API密钥和Content-Type等参数。构建 HTTP使用PHP的curl函数向OpenAI API发送HTTP请求,并...
在PHP中对接OpenAI API,你可以按照以下步骤进行: 了解OpenAI的API文档和认证机制: 访问OpenAI API文档,了解可用的API端点、请求参数和响应格式。 OpenAI API使用Bearer Token进行认证,你需要获取并配置API密钥。在PHP项目中引入OpenAI的API库或自行实现API请求: ...
OpenAI PHP is a community-maintained PHP API client that allows you to interact with the Open AI API.Follow the creator Nuno Maduro: YouTube: youtube.com/@nunomaduro— Videos every weekday Twitch: twitch.tv/enunomaduro— Streams (almost) every weekday Twitter / X: x.com/enunomaduro ...
PHP调用openai api chatgpt示例 申请OpenAI账号 过程略 最终得到api_key 每个账号在调用API的额度这块,有5美元的免费额度,按照对应模型和对应tokens/1k的价格消耗完后就需要充值了 chat completion 这里给出对话场景的调用代码,prompt类型的completion接口同理,只是参数格式与响应格式需要参照文档修改下...
<?php namespace app\controller; use support\Request; use Webman\Openai\Embedding; use Workerman\Protocols\Http\Chunk; class EmbeddingController { public function create(Request $request) { $connection = $request->connection; $embedding = new Embedding(['apikey' => 'sk-xxx', 'api' => 'https...
sudo apt-get install php-curl 接下来,请确保您已经获得了OpenAI API密钥。如果您还没有API密钥,请访问OpenAI网站并按照指示进行操作。步骤二:编写代码 现在,我们可以开始编写代码了。以下是一个简单的PHP代码示例,用于对接OpenAI的API接口:<?php$openai_key = 'YOUR_API_KEY';$endpoint = '<https://api...
php// OpenAI Completion API endpoint$api_url="https://api.openai.com/v1/completions";// Your API key$api_key="YOUR_API_KEY_GOES_HERE";// Text prompt$text_prompt="Hello,how are you?";// Request body$request_body=array("model"=>"text-davinci-002","prompt"=>$text_prompt,"...